A key group of cerebral amygdala neurons identified in anxiety and social disorders

A team from the Institute for Neurosciences reveals that restoring the balance between two amygdala regions reverses depression, anxiety, and autism-like behaviors in mice. This finding opens new avenues for treating affective disorders by targeting a specific neural circuit. First discovery of how an autism-linked mutation reduces vasopressin and alters social behavior

This study from the Institute for Neurosciences shows that vasopressin, a neuropeptide, regulates sociability and social aggression. The results, published in Nature Communications, open the door to treatments that could restore social deficits in autism spectrum disorder without altering social aggression by targeting specific vasopressin receptors. Physical and cognitive environmental stimuli achieve molecular rejuvenation of the brain

– A study led by CSIC researchers describes the first molecular atlas of the hippocampus during ageing in mice. – These results could provide a molecular basis for explaining the benefits of staying active during old age and inform the design of healthy ageing policies. Researchers from the Institute for Neuroscience unveil a novel strategy to combat melanoma brain metastases

This study reveals the key role of microglia, brain’s immune cells, in brain metastases progression and identifies a strategy to manipulate them to promote antitumor responses. This finding, published in Cancer Cell, could enhance the effectiveness of immunotherapy in patients with brain metastases.
